Filtration Capacity and Flow Rate
The primary consideration is ensuring the system can handle your pool’s size and debris load. A 420 sq ft system typically supports pools up to approximately 20,000 gallons, but flow rate is equally important. Higher flow rates allow for quicker filtration cycles and better circulation, especially in larger or more heavily used pools. Be cautious of systems with high filtration area but low flow rates, as this can lead to stagnation and algae growth.
Compatibility and Cartridge Availability
Ensuring the system fits your existing pool setup and that replacement cartridges are readily available is vital. Many systems are designed to work with popular brands like Pentair, but some may require adapters or custom fittings. Opting for widely compatible cartridges, like Pleatco or Filbur, can make maintenance easier and cheaper over time—avoid proprietary cartridges that are hard to find or expensive.
Build Quality and Durability
Cartridge material and construction impact how long the system lasts and how well it resists wear and tear. Heavy-duty trilobal fabrics typically outperform cheaper materials by resisting tearing and clogging. Consider systems with corrosion-resistant housings and sturdy fittings, especially if your pool is exposed to harsh weather or chemicals. Cheaper systems may save money upfront but often require more frequent replacement.
Ease of Maintenance
Frequent cleaning and cartridge replacement are part of pool ownership. Systems with easy access to cartridges and straightforward disassembly save time and reduce frustration. Some models feature quick-release latches or tool-less access, which are worth paying extra for if you want to minimize maintenance effort. Avoid overly complex systems that require special tools or extensive disassembly.
Cost and Value
While higher-priced systems tend to offer better durability and performance, it’s essential to balance cost with your specific needs. Consider long-term expenses like replacement cartridges and maintenance parts. Investing in a slightly more expensive but higher-flow, durable system can save money in the long run, especially if it reduces downtime and cartridge replacements. Conversely, for small or infrequently used pools, a basic model may suffice.
Frequently Asked Questions
How often should I replace the cartridges in a 420 sq ft system?
Cartridge replacement frequency depends on pool usage and water conditions, but generally, cartridges should be cleaned every 4-6 weeks and replaced every 1-2 years. Regular cleaning extends cartridge life and maintains filtration efficiency. If you notice a significant drop in flow rate or water clarity, it’s a sign the cartridges need replacement sooner. Using high-quality cartridges can also prolong their lifespan and improve overall system performance.
Can I upgrade my existing system to a 420 sq ft capacity?
Upgrading to a larger capacity system often involves replacing the entire filter housing and cartridge assembly. Compatibility with your pool’s plumbing is essential, so check dimensions and inlet/outlet sizes before upgrading. In many cases, it’s more cost-effective to replace the entire filtration system if your current setup is outdated or incompatible. Consult with a pool professional to ensure the new system fits seamlessly with your existing equipment.
What is the main advantage of choosing a 420 sq ft filter system?
A 420 sq ft system offers an excellent balance of filtration capacity and flow rate for most residential pools up to around 20,000 gallons. It provides efficient debris removal, maintains water clarity, and often reduces the frequency of cartridge cleaning. However, larger systems can be bulkier and more expensive, so consider your pool size and space constraints when choosing.
Are compatible cartridges readily available, or will I face supply issues?
Many reputable systems use standard cartridges from brands like Pleatco, Filbur, or Unicel, which are widely available online and in pool stores. Choosing a system with common cartridge models can prevent supply chain issues and reduce replacement costs. Avoid proprietary cartridges unless they are easily accessible, as this can lead to delays or higher expenses.
Is it better to invest in a premium system or a budget option?
If your pool sees frequent use or is exposed to heavy debris, investing in a premium system with higher flow rates, better materials, and longer cartridge life is worthwhile. For occasional or small pools, a budget model might suffice, but keep in mind it may require more frequent maintenance or replacement. Balancing initial costs with long-term durability and performance is key to making the right choice.
